Spark Plugs Ignite Your Nissan's Engine

Spark plugs are small but essential components that create the electrical spark needed to ignite the air-fuel mixture in your engine's combustion chambers. Each cylinder has its own spark plug that fires at precisely the right moment to keep your engine running smoothly. These components endure extreme temperatures, pressures, and electrical stress, making quality construction and proper specifications critical for engine performance.

How Spark Plugs Create Combustion

Spark plugs receive high-voltage electrical current from the ignition coils through their terminals. This electricity jumps across a small gap between the center and ground electrodes, creating a spark that ignites the compressed air-fuel mixture. The resulting combustion drives the piston downward, producing power. This process happens thousands of times per minute in each cylinder. The plug's heat range determines how quickly it dissipates heat, preventing pre-ignition while avoiding fouling. Your ignition system depends on spark plugs maintaining the correct gap and clean electrodes. Why Spark Plugs Wear Out

Electrode erosion from repeated sparking gradually increases the gap beyond specifications, requiring higher voltage to fire and reducing ignition efficiency. Carbon deposits accumulate on electrodes from incomplete combustion, particularly during short trips or idling. Oil consumption can foul plugs, coating electrodes with residue that prevents proper sparking. Incorrect heat range causes either pre-ignition or fouling problems. When to Replace Spark Plugs

Follow your vehicle's maintenance schedule for spark plug replacement intervals, typically between 30,000 and 100,000 miles depending on plug type. Replace plugs immediately if you experience rough idling, hesitation during acceleration, or reduced fuel economy. Difficulty starting or engine misfires also indicate spark plug problems.
